Mr. Jameson is walking toward his nine-story hotel and stops to look up to the top of the building. The angle of elevation to the top of the hotel is 40°. If the height of the hotel is 108 feet, about how far away is Mr. Jameson from the hotel?

OpenStudy (anonymous):

You can turn this into a trig problem: |dw:1384872921381:dw| You know the opposite leg of the triangle, so you should be able to use the tangent of the angle to calculate the adjacent leg. Do you know how that works, or do you need help figuring that out?
